Almost no responses in the $100k+ incomes. I wonder if that's a general problem with the method?


It could be a general problem. For collecting responses from high-income individuals the method faces the double-whammy of: (1) smaller number of potential respondents; (2) respondents are least willing to spend their time on such surveys (or the sites the survey-wall blocks).
